Latest Patents
One of his latest patents is an "Apparatus for organized loading and unloading of objects." This invention addresses the limitations of conventional equipment that typically handle either loading or unloading operations. Bhaskara's apparatus is designed to perform both functions efficiently, ensuring safety and minimizing damage to the objects being handled. The system utilizes various components such as belt conveyors, manipulators, vacuum generators, and object gripping systems to optimize the loading and unloading processes.
